Abstract
686,873. Transformers and inductances; electromagnets. BRITISH THOMSONHOUSTON CO., Ltd. Dec. 5, 1950 [Dec. 22, 1949], No. 29756/50. Drawings to Specification. Classes 35 and 38 (ii). A magnetic core for electromagnetic induction apparatus has at least one joint and comprises a plurality of stacked laminations, each of which is shaped to have substantially straight leg and yoke portions at right angles to one another, the laminations being secured together by a line weld positioned at or near the line defined by the joint in the core and across the edges of the lamination on the surface thereof. In a core having butt joints the weld is preferably situated across the edges of the laminations at the line of the joint, whilst in a core having butt and lap joints three line welds per joint are used, two being positioned outside the lines defined by the joints and one weld intermediate these two. In another embodiment a rectangular core is built of substantially planar L- shaped laminations, having line welds across the edges of the core at the lines defined by the joints whilst additional spot welds are made at the joints on the faces of the outermost laminations.
